Consider how Rei changes her opinion of others. First she is negative towards Shinji, but after spending some time with him and getting to know him among the stars, and also Shinji showing some affection, she's able to produce a smile for him. Simultaneously, Rei discovering this makes her reconsider her other relationships, in particular Gendo's. It's not a coincidence that Rei afterwards makes a comment that "she's not the favorite", indicating a souring relationship, or reflecting over the fact that she could easily thank Shinji for his help/kindness, but she had never, ever said "Thank you" to Gendo before. But after episode 23, there is of course a big change. It's an important episode, because in this episode Rei gets to see her inner heart, and get a taste of those bottled up feelings she had been hiding. She starts crying. Then she dies, and whens he resurrects: Gendo never came to visit her apparently, something Shinji remarks on. Afterwards, Rei is seen crushing Gendo's glasses.

This is something that had been building for some time, as in the end it becomes clear that the reason Rei is so suicidal is because part of her wants out of the prison Gendo created for her, but she's bound by duty to help others.
